Hi all,

I've been on the trying to conceive journey now for 2 years, with 3 losses (2 miscarriages, one ectopic with one D&C).
I've now been put on a plan with the NHS which is overseen by Dr Shehata as I'm in epsom. I think our hospital is the only NHS one that he works at.
Anyway, I've been diagnosed with high and very active NK cells and have started on 400mg a day of hydroxychloroquine.

One symptom I've noticed which not many people seem to have is real fatigue and always a sensitive tummy. It's become a real struggle and I know I have months of this ahead along with more meds including steroids.

I'd like to know if anyone has experienced the same with this medication and if it tapers off at all?
It's been 6 weeks and I still feel the same. After 10 hours of sleep I wake up feeling groggy and the feeling stays all day :(

Thanks in advance for any advice!
